微波EDA网,见证研发工程师的成长!
首页 > 研发问答 > 微电子和IC设计 > IC后端设计交流 > DC综合set_fix_multiple_port_nets

DC综合set_fix_multiple_port_nets

时间:10-02 整理:3721RD 点击:
菜鸟求助:
set_fix_multiple_port_nets-all-buffer_constant
和set_fix_multiple_port_nets-all-buffer_constant[get_designs"*"-hier]
的区别和作用

第一句话是让每个port都有单独的buffer驱动的意思,
第二句话不知道,估计是做hier设计时用的

不设对综合有什么弊端?

不设对综合没什么影响
主要的影响是布局布线
在布局布线的时候,如果直接连通的线上没有buf会导致一些优化不能进行

ls说的是没设综合后的网表中有assign,所以要设避免assign的原因?
如果有违例,布局布线的时候不会根据时序的要求在这种路径上添加buf吗?

assign会被解释成一条wire,试想一下,一条路径起点到终点见如果是一个没有cell的wire,会有什么结果?

两句话没有多大区别的,那一句都可以的

xuexila

网表里的assign可以让后端工具加buf去掉。

明白了,谢谢

值得学习!

第一个是 让直接相连的net之间插buffer
第二个是这种相连可用于hier cell

学习下

学了习~

这个命令主要是解决 有assign时使端口的例化问题,
不知道对不对

DC综合后产生过assign的警告,看帮助文档说要加set_fix_multiple_port_nets-all-buffer_constant ,目的是在每个输出PORT前加个BUFFER来提高驱动能力吗?APR时在输出PORT前人工插入BUFFER不行吗?

受教了

应该可以的

好东西要支持

学习了,感谢!

学习啦 ,谢谢

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top